Location: This place is appr 2 miles west of Pontotoc, TX and fronts on the north side of Hwy 71. It is located mostly in Mason county with a bit in San Saba county.
Wells: There are three wells on the ranch. Two of the wells are irrigation wells. One has a 50 horse power electric pump, and the other has a 30 horse power pump on it which provides abundant water supply to the 3 circle irrigation pivots on the place. These 3 circles irrigate appr 64 acres of coastal Bermuda grass. One other well has a small pump that furnishes water for the livestock.
Improvements: There are no buildings on the property. The improvements included the wells and the pivot irrigation systems, which are highly productive for the raising of grasses, hay, or a rotational grazing system for livestock. There is one earthen pond that can be filled with the nearby irrigation pump.

Remarks: This is one of the most productive places you can find in the Hill Country. The grass fields are in great shape, and the place is fenced to manage livestock in a dererment system to maximize the productivity of the grasses and water. There are two hills that are left native with big live oaks, post oaks, and mesquites. These are great cover for the wildlife! White tail deer, turkeys, feral hogs, and native varmints abound!
